视频识别SDK有哪些常见功能?
随着人工智能技术的不断发展,视频识别SDK在各个领域得到了广泛应用。视频识别SDK作为一种基于视频内容分析的软件开发工具包,具有丰富的功能,可以帮助开发者快速实现视频内容识别、分析和处理。本文将详细介绍视频识别SDK的常见功能。
一、人脸识别
人脸识别是视频识别SDK的核心功能之一,它能够识别视频中的人脸,并进行人脸特征提取、比对和追踪。具体功能如下:
人脸检测:通过图像处理技术,在视频中检测出人脸的位置和大小。
人脸特征提取:提取人脸的关键特征,如眼睛、鼻子、嘴巴等,以便进行后续的人脸比对。
人脸比对:将视频中的人脸与数据库中的人脸进行比对,实现身份认证。
人脸追踪:在视频中实时追踪人脸,实现跨场景、跨视频的人脸识别。
二、物体识别
物体识别是视频识别SDK的另一个重要功能,它能够识别视频中出现的各种物体,并进行分类、计数和追踪。具体功能如下:
物体检测:在视频中检测出物体的位置和大小。
物体分类:将检测到的物体进行分类,如车辆、行人、动物等。
物体计数:对特定类型的物体进行计数,如车辆数量、行人数量等。
物体追踪:在视频中实时追踪物体,实现跨场景、跨视频的物体识别。
三、行为识别
行为识别是视频识别SDK的高级功能,它能够识别视频中的人体行为,如行走、奔跑、跳跃等。具体功能如下:
行为检测:在视频中检测出人体行为,如行走、奔跑、跳跃等。
行为分类:将检测到的人体行为进行分类,如正常行走、异常行走等。
行为追踪:在视频中实时追踪人体行为,实现跨场景、跨视频的行为识别。
四、视频摘要
视频摘要功能可以将长时间的视频内容进行压缩,提取出关键帧和动作,便于用户快速了解视频内容。具体功能如下:
关键帧提取:从视频中提取出具有代表性的关键帧,展示视频的主要内容。
动作提取:提取视频中的人体动作,如行走、奔跑、跳跃等。
视频压缩:对视频内容进行压缩,减少存储空间,提高传输效率。
五、异常检测
异常检测是视频识别SDK的安全功能,它能够识别视频中的异常行为,如打架、闯入、火灾等。具体功能如下:
异常行为检测:在视频中检测出异常行为,如打架、闯入、火灾等。
异常报警:当检测到异常行为时,立即向用户发送报警信息。
异常追踪:在视频中实时追踪异常行为,实现跨场景、跨视频的异常检测。
六、场景识别
场景识别是视频识别SDK的功能之一,它能够识别视频中的场景,如室内、室外、商场、学校等。具体功能如下:
场景检测:在视频中检测出场景类型,如室内、室外、商场、学校等。
场景分类:将检测到的场景进行分类,便于用户了解视频环境。
总之,视频识别SDK具有丰富多样的功能,可以帮助开发者快速实现视频内容识别、分析和处理。随着人工智能技术的不断发展,视频识别SDK将在更多领域得到应用,为人们的生活带来更多便利。
猜你喜欢:环信即时通讯云